Easy Cracker Candy Recipe
Ingredients
- 25-30 thin wheat crackers or something similar
- 1/2 cup chocolate chips
- 2 teaspoons sea salt large granules
Instructions
- In a microwave safe bowl, microwave the chocolate chips in 20 second intervals, stirring after each one, until almost melted.
- Once most chips are melted but there are still chunks of chocolate left, remove from microwave and stir until totally melted.
- Dip cracker halfway, tapping off excess chocolate.
- Place on parchment (waxed paper works too) lined baking sheet.
- Sprinkle lightly with sea salt.
- Place in refrigerator to set, about 5 minutes.
